Kodi Can Handle Tons of Files

One of the things I love about Kodi is its versatility. This app works on nearly every platform—macOS, Windows, Linux, Android, iOS, and even smart TVs! I primarily use Kodi on my Windows laptop, and I found it incredibly easy to install. Upon launching it, I was greeted with a full-screen view that instantly made me feel immersed in my media library.

Kodi has a user-friendly interface that feels fresh compared to VLC. Its side menu clearly lists different categories like Movies, TV Shows, Music, and more. This organization makes it easy to find exactly what you’re looking for, which is a game changer compared to the sometimes clunky navigation in VLC.

The best part? Kodi allows you to store files in their respective categories, making your media library tidier than ever. Plus, you can seamlessly switch between devices—watch a movie on your laptop and then continue on your Apple TV 4K.

Features That Make Kodi Worth Switching To

Kodi does more than just store files; it offers a wealth of features that enhance your media experience. Whether you want to showcase your latest vacation photos or organize your music, Kodi can do it all. Just upload your photo albums, and you can easily display them on a big screen without the hassle of mirroring your phone. I recently did this after a trip and found it far superior to the blurry images that often come from screen mirroring.

Another fantastic feature of Kodi is its metadata import capabilities. If you’re adding your own movies or TV shows to the library, Kodi can automatically fetch movie posters and information about the cast from the internet. This makes your library look professional and much more visually appealing.

Additionally, Kodi is not just about passive viewing. Want to check the weather? Just log into Kodi and select a weather service. Voila, you have both current conditions and a forecast for the day!

If you’re tired of paying for cable or multiple streaming services, Kodi has a PVR function that allows you to record and stream live TV. It integrates with backend services like MediaPortal and NextPVR, so you can save all your favorite shows in one place. You can even keep your music library organized without the need to visit various apps like iTunes.

Kodi supports high-end audio and video formats like 4K Ultra HD, Dolby Atmos, and HDR, which blew my mind. I expected Kodi to be just a storage solution, but it turned out to be so much more!

Customizable and User-Friendly Interface

Kodi stands out thanks to its well-organized layout and easy-to-read menus. The full-screen mode is refreshing because it allows you to focus solely on your media. Moreover, you can customize the appearance with various skins, making the player uniquely yours.
